Mental health challenges, attempted suicide, and suicide continue to be major challenges for people in America (particularly those between 15-24 and over 60). These challenges can be hidden and are often complicated, so we must enter into all of these situations with wisdom and prayerful dependence upon the Lord. In order to increase awareness and provide meaningful guidance for God’s people into these challenges, the document below provides a list of warning signs for suicide and an action plan to prayerfully follow in light of these signs.

If someone seems particularly down and you suspect they may be at risk for suicide (see warning signs within the pdf), communicate this immediately to a CPC Pastor or Shepherding Elder.  If you would like further education and pastoral and biblical guidance on these issues, you can also pick up any of the relevant CCEF booklets at the CPC book table or talk with a church officer.
